Setting Up Business VoIP – What You Need to Consider

It is important to make sure that you research all of the options available to you and make sure that you have a clear picture of what you need and what is going to work for you.

1. Is your current network capacity able to sustain network flow?

You need to ensure that you have a proper LAN set up for your Business VoIP system as without this network you will not be able to fully utilise all of the services that VoIP can provide your business with.

2. What is your current bandwidth and internet connection like?

You need to be aware of what your internet bandwidth is as you will need proper bandwidth for your Business VoIP services to function at full capacity.

3. What are your calling habits like?

If your business calls have you phoning international numbers and making long distance calls, then VoIP will without question, help you to save on phone bills.

4. Should you keep your existing land line?

Because VoIP systems require you to be connected to the internet, if you lose your internet connection, then you will also lose your phone system. With this in mind it is always worth keeping your PSTN landline as a backup.

5. Hosted IP Platform or Premise?

Hosted IP Platforms allow you to manage your own Business VoIP telephone system and this is especially useful if you have a small company and you want to cut out the middle man.

6. What VoIP service plan should you go for?

There are lot of Business VoIP service plans available with a plethora of options so making sure that you do your research is vital. You should look into how much you pay for long distance calls, international calls, what kind of set up fees you are expected to pay and what you will have to pay on a monthly basis to your provider.

7. What kind of VoIP Equipment should you use?

You are likely to be provided with basic Business VoIP equipment when you sign up for the service but it is best to find out what kind of facilities you and your business need and then finding equipment that fits these needs.

8. What if your budget and what kind of ROI are you expecting?

The most important consideration that you can make when thinking about upgrading your communications system to a Business VoIP system is how much you have to spend. Do you want to pay monthly? Do you want to pay one one-off fee? How much are you going to save by switching from your existing landline to a Business VoIP solution?

Weigh everything up before making your decision is vital, so following these simple and obvious points can help you to make the right decision about your Business VoIP solution.
